titleOfInvention Method of correction of thromboplastingeneration at patients with metabolic syndrome
abstract FIELD: medicine. n SUBSTANCE: invention concerns correction thromboplastingeneration at at patients with metabolic syndrome (MS). For this purpose within 6 months carry out the complex therapy including individually chosen hypohigh-calorie diet, rationally dosed out static and dynamic exercise stresses, and also introduction of preparations - Metforminum on 500 mg 2 times a day after meal, Valsartan 80 mg - 1 time a day and Rozuvastatin 10 mg in the evening. n EFFECT: effective correction of thromboplastinopoiesis at patients with MS at the expense of potentiation of therapeutic effect of separate components of complex therapy. n 1 ex
